15. Living the way God intended
Ecc. 12:13: “Fear God and keep 613 laws.”
Psalm 15: David boils it down to 11 laws.
Micah 6:8: The prophet shortens it to 3 laws.
Matthew 22:37-40: Jesus brought it down to 2.
